Taking your little one on their first ride is a thrilling adventure. With a balance bike, they can master balance and coordination before ever touching pedals. Balance bikes are designed for young cyclists ages 3 to 7 years old, providing a safe and supportive way to develop essential skills.
Before you hit the pavement, let's explore to keep in mind. The right size bike will ensure comfort and control. Look for a bike with adjustable seats and handlebars so it can grow with your child. Safety comes first. Choose a helmet that fits snugly and always accompany them while riding.

Conquering the Balance Bike
Learning to balance on a balance bike is a fun experience for young riders. It teaches them the fundamentals of steering before they even touch pedals. A good balance bike should have a low seat, wide handlebars and durable wheels that are comfortable. As your child learns, encourage them to focus forward. This helps them achieve their equilibrium. Once they feel confident, they can start to coast for longer distances. Remember, patience is key!
